Age Logic Cellulaire Review

Fine lines and wrinkles appear to be at the surface of the skin but they actually start deep within the layers of our skin. The signs of aging are a result of our slowing skin cells. As skin cells age and begin to lose function, the skin begins to sag and wrinkles appear.

Age Logic Cellulaire is an anti-wrinkle cream that claims to reduce the appearance of sagging skin, fine lines and wrinkles. It promises to regenerate aging skin cells that have become inactive and lost function.

What Makes Age Logic Cellulaire Effective?

1. Vitamin C and E are natural antioxidants that guard against free radical damage. Free radicals invade skin cells, causing damage and the breakdown of collagen and elastin. As a result, the signs of aging are accelerated.
2. Actinergie improves cell function and renewal by providing oxygen and increased metabolism.
3. ATP is a biological molecule that reenergizes sluggish skin cells, allowing proper function and increased blood flow.
4. Cellular Life Complex is formulated with 17 vitamins, 21 amino acids and 16 biological ingredients that specialize in the renewal of skin cells to promote healthy, younger skin
5. Glycerin is a natural humectant which works to attract and retain moisture, keeping the skin hydrated.

Is Age Logic Cellulaire Safe For My Skin?

The active ingredients in Age Logic Cellulaire do not have any major side effects linked to them and are known to be safe. However, this product does contain several parabens which can cause allergic reaction, breakouts or irritation in sensitive skin. Parabens are preservatives which help to extend a products shelf life but are not necessary for product performance. We would not recommend using Age Logic Cellulaire if you have sensitive skin.

Is Age Logic Cellulaire a Good Value?

Age Logic Cellulaire costs $140 for a 1.6 oz jar making it an expensive product. Treatment creams tend to be more expensive as they do more than just moisturize the skin. This product contains nearly 100 anti-aging ingredients that are clinically proven to reduce the signs of aging. Although it is expensive, Age Logic Cellulaire is priced accurately.
